Egg eating snakes only eat bird eggs. Very strict diet and they can be hard to feed too. It's normal for them to go months without eating cause I believe in the wild they eat when eggs are available which are usually on bird laying eggs season. I heard its tricky too cause you just got to watch...
Eggs gotta be raw. Egg eating snakes eat by swallowing the egg whole. They don't have teeth but they have bones like few inches behind their head (for adult) to puncture the egg, then they squeeze them. Once done they spit out the egg shell. Its pretty interesting how they eat. And also look so...
Yes quail eggs are much easier to find, but for baby egg eating snakes, they needed bird eggs not bigger that finch eggs cause they cant swallow quail eggs yet. Finding canary or finch eggs are so hard even for infertile.
